AC/DC is a hard rock band formed in Sydney, Australia 1973 by rhythm guitarist Malcom Young, and his brother, lead guitarist Angus. The band has sold over 150 million albums worldwide, making them one of the most successful hard rock acts ever. Their 1980 album Back in Black has sold 42 million copies and is the second highest selling album of all time. The band has had two distinctive lead singers and its fans divide its history into the Bon Scott era and the Brian Johnson era.
